How they compare
Belgium currently reports 2.3 against 2.2 in Netherlands, a difference of 0.1.
The two have swapped places 12 times across 30 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Belgium ahead.
Belgium ranks 10th and Netherlands ranks 11th of 31 countries.
Belgium has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belgium | Netherlands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1.25 | 0.95 | 0.3 | Belgium |
| 2000s | 3.83 | 1.91 | 1.92 | Belgium |
| 2010s | 1.65 | 1.06 | 0.59 | Belgium |
| 2020s | 5.12 | 4.65 | 0.4667 | Belgium |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
